Mnarani Aquarium

The project

The goal of Mnarani Aquarium is to contribute to the conservation of endangered sea turtles, by aiding those that live off the coast of Zanzibar. We take care of sea turtles that were hurt in accidents or accidentally caught by local fishermen. Once they are able to continue living in the wild by themselves, we release the sea turtles on our official sea turtle release day. Working as a
Volunteer

As a volunteer at Mnarani Aquarium you will participate in a variety of activities. Most of your time will be spent taking care of the turtles. For example, you will feed juvenile turtles with small fish, feed adult turtles with seagrass and examine  turtles to make sure that they are not injured. During breeding season, you will also aid in the collection of turtle eggs on beaches, where they are threatened by human activities.

Besides the activities that are directly related to the turtles, there are other tasks, in which volunteers participate. Among them are seaweed gathering on the beach to feed the turtles, changing the water in the pools for the juvenile turtles and cleaning the beach, which is an activity that is part of a community project. You will also get the opportunity to guide tourists through the Aquarium, teach them about turtles and explain the project to them.

If you are lucky and working as a volunteer on the 20th of February, you will participate in our annual release-day and get a chance to witness the turtles return to the sea.

Here at Mnarani Aquarium we place a huge emphasis on improving the living conditions of the turtles that we are taking care of. We encourage volunteers to contribute their own ideas to the project and collaborate with us on their implementation. For example a volunteer who was studying Marine Biology collected data about our turtles and added them to an international database, which enables the monitoring of the turtles behaviour after their release back into the sea. Another contribution of volunteers was the painting of a wall with safety and hygiene guidelines, to ensure a safe encounter between tourists visiting Mnarani Aquarium and our turtles. We are always keen on adopting new ideas and do everything we can to implement them.

The cost of volunteering at Mnarani Aquarium

Visa &
Work-Permit

To enter Tanzania/ Zanzibar, you will need to apply for a Visa. The processing fee is 50$. Since you are „working“ as a volunteer, you are also required by law to acquire a work-permit, which costs 200$ for a timespan of 3 months. We handle the technical aspects of obtaining the Work-Permit and will not charge you.

Dormitory

As a volunteer at Mnarani Aquarium you are free to choose your accomodation. However we highly recommend the Aquarium Beach House as your place to stay at during your time as a volunteer. It is situated right next to the Aquarium and has just recently been build. Since most volunteers choose to stay at the Beach House, the staff is accustomed to volunteers and can take care of your needs very well. The prices per night at the Aquarium Beach House are 50$ (Single Bedroom) and 35 $ (Double Bedroom). Both prices include three freshly cooked meals per day.

Transport

The Airport of Zanzibar is located approximately 80km southwest of Nungwi. We offer a taxi-service to and from the Airport to the Aquarium. The cost for a return trip is 80$, a one-way trip costs 50$. The drivers we hire for the service are well-experienced in the transport of tourists and speak English fluently. We highly recommend using either our service or a registered taxi-company, since taxis at the airport are often operated by sketchy businessmen and public transport is usually overcrowded.

Summary

Whilst the opportunity to work at Mnarani Aquarium is free, there are some expenses you should consider when planning your trip. To give you an example how much a  two-week stay as a volunteer may cost: 

 

 

250$ (Visa & Work-Permit)

700$ (Single Bedroom)

80$ (Transport – Airport)

 

sum: 1030$ (excluding flight)
